U.S. Census enumerators were instructed to write the state or country of birth. They were not instructed to write the specific location of birth. Very, very, very, very few enumerators misunderstood and wrote a specific location of birth but that is rare. Nordic meant Scandinavian (Danish, Swedish, Norwegian, etc.) and the next column is the language spoken to further clarify where the person came from.

If she came in 1870, you should be able to find her in the 1880 and 1900 U.S. Federal Censuses too and if she came in time, maybe she can be found in the 1870 census. Remember that the 1900 U.S. Federal Census provides a month and year of birth, which helps narrow things down a bit. The 1900 census will provide another chance to check a year of immigration.

Marriage APPLICATIONS often provide additional clues, such as names of parents or a place of birth and I've sometimes found a specific location instead of just Sweden.

Check out the Swenson Center, mentioned in my last post. Many have found the Swedish parish of origin there and the parish was where records were kept in the parish. Since she married a Swedish man, it seems quite likely they attended a Swedish American church so that may be your best chance to learn more about her. I've learned a huge amount from those records.

Church, obituaries (especially from a Swedish American newspaper) and other records should have a birthdate or at least an age at death, which can be used to get a fairly good estimate of when she was born.
